WLStack Transport is built on an advanced underlying optical-network architecture, offering flexible bandwidth from Mb-level SDN access to 100G dedicated wavelengths, with strict bandwidth and latency guarantees, link redundancy, load balancing and physical-layer isolation — for finance, industrial internet, CDN and edge origin pull that demand determinism and security.

Nationwide transport backbone

An OTN-based national backbone topology spanning major cities and aggregation nodes, with OADM flexible add/drop, OLP optical-line protection and backup routing — ensuring high availability and deterministic latency for long-haul circuits.
